MoIT launches sites to deal with e-co妹妹erce disputes, counterfeit goods

HÀ NỘI — Counterfeit goods have always been a major concern in Việt Nam. Whether it's fashion items, electronic equipment, or even medicine, the problem of authenticity is often an issue.

But now the Ministry of Industry and Trade (MoIT) is fighting back – launching three websites to help consumers resolve disputes.

“The e-co妹妹erce market is growing in Việt Nam, but it is also used to trade counterfeit goods with increasingly sophisticated activities online,” said Deputy Minister Cao Quốc Hưng.

“The MoIT opens the portals to fight against and prevent such issues in e-co妹妹erce, creating trust for consumers.”

The portals including a website for managing and monitoring e-co妹妹erce exchanges at , a website for reporting disputes in e-co妹妹erce at and a website for reporting on e-co妹妹erce activities of businesses at

Hưng also said his ministry has issued a plan to strengthen the fight against counterfeit goods, unidentified goods and goods that infringe intellectual property rights in e-co妹妹erce, and the portals are part of the plan.

The portals will connect and share information between the ministry and the relevant offices, such as the Department of Electronic Co妹妹erce and Digital Economy, the General Department of Market Management, Department of Competition and the Consumer Protection Department.

They also manage and solve complaints and disputes for consumers.

Earlier in April, MoIT signed co妹妹itments with adayroi.com, lazada.vn, shopee.vn, sendo.vn and tiki.vn to ensure fake goods are not sold online.
